None of the infants within the scientific tests explained over made harmful quick-phrase Negative effects within the probiotics. Nonetheless, the extended-expression effects of receiving probiotics at such a younger age are uncertain.

Probiotics could consist of several different microorganisms. The most typical are micro organism that belong to groups named Lactobacillus and Bifidobacterium. Other bacteria might also be utilized as probiotics, and so may possibly yeasts which include Saccharomyces boulardii.

The risk of hazardous outcomes from probiotics is larger in people with serious sicknesses or compromised immune systems. When probiotics are increasingly being deemed for high-threat folks, such as premature infants or seriously sick hospital people, the potential challenges of probiotics need to be cautiously weighed versus their Added benefits.

The Orphan Drug Act recognized several incentives for the development of medicines for uncommon conditions, including general public funding, tax credits, waivers of submitting fees, and seven-calendar year industry exclusivity36,38,39. The orphan drug designation isn't going to require demonstration of included affected person reward. Also, medication for uncommon diseases and conditions frequently qualify for expedited designations and regulatory pathways, adaptability in the look of studies needed to reveal the success and to ascertain safety, along with a shorter progress time than other drugs40.

If once the FDA’s assessment of a foods additive or GRAS component we have identified its use fulfills our security normal, the regulatory standing from the foodstuff additive or GRAS component would keep on being unchanged. If following the FDA’s evaluation of a meals additive or GRAS ingredient, We've got identified its use doesn't meet up with our protection normal, the company will take various steps to safeguard community overall health. These steps involve issuing a general public warning letter to companies that manufacture or distribute the food items component and/or food stuff made up of the food stuff component, issuing a community warn, and using enforcement action to halt distribution of your food component and foods made up of it to the grounds that this sort of foods are or comprise an unapproved foodstuff additive.
